>From RFC 2616: Hypertext Transfer Protocol -- HTTP/1.1
>(can be found online at "ftp://ftp.isi.edu/in-notes/rfc2616.txt";).
>206 Partial Content: The server has fulfilled the partial GET
>request for the resource.
>
>That is, if a client requests part of the content and the server
>delivers that part, the server successfully fulfills the request.
>The size of the request is not a factor.  Whether or not the
>server successfully fulfills the request is the only factor.

>>By default analog counts status 206 as a distinct successful reference. 
>>However, I have a large file that gets downloaded from my site. 
>>
>>In looking at my access log, I notice that sometimes a download of my
>large 
>>file is complete with one 200 entry. 
>>
>>But other times, the file has multiple entries, 200 being the first entry 
>>followed by multiple 206 entries. 
>>
>>I think this is caused by the browser requesting smaller portions at a
>time in 
>>order to download the whole file in smaller pieces. 
>>
>>If this is correct, it would seem that I should only count the 200s in
>order to 
>>get the actual number of distinct download requests for the individual
>file. 
>>
>>But since analog counts 206s by default, I wonder if I am understaind
>this 
>>correctly.
